Chilled Out Meetups is one of Leeds biggest groups organising social events for 18 to 38 year olds. First time here? See information for new members by clicking this link.
Our events include an organised walk every other week (over summer), coffee and drinks socials, women-only events and one off visits to destinations in Leeds and sometimes further out. We also run 'one off' events from time to time, and hope to add more types of activities in future.

Super exciting event coming to Leeds which shouldn't be missed... Wonderland Leeds is an immersive Alice in Wonderland themed walk around the Leeds City Centre. There are installations spread out over multiple locations, each one telling part of this classic tale. We'll meet at the Corn Exchange steps then do a walking tour and check out each location.

Walk Details
- Destination: Apperley Bridge rail station where we will catch the train back into Leeds (or you can connect to other transport methods)
- Distance: 10 miles.
- Challenge: Most of the towpath is now paved. This walk is entirely on the flat with no hills to climb. This is the longest route of the year, but keep in mind you can end the walk early since there are other train and bus connections all along the canal.
- Clothing: Wear the comfiest trainers you have to prevent blisters. Boots are not required for this.
